public class TwitterResource extends AffirmationResource {
TwitterResource(Set<String> flags, HashMap<String,String> params, URI uri) {
super(flags, params, uri);
}
private String getTwitterStream(String screenName) {
String results = null;
// Step 1: Encode consumer key and secret
try {
// URL encode the consumer key and secret
String urlApiKey = URLEncoder.encode("6IhPnWbYxASAoAzH2QaUtHD0J", "UTF-8");
String urlApiSecret = URLEncoder.encode("L0GnuiOnapWbSBbQtLIqtpeS5BTtvh06dmoMoKQfHQS8UwHuWm", "UTF-8");
// Concatenate the encoded consumer key, a colon character, and the
// encoded consumer secret
String combined = urlApiKey + ":" + urlApiSecret;
// Base64 encode the string
String base64Encoded = Base64.encodeToString(combined.getBytes(), Base64.NO_WRAP);
// Step 2: Obtain a bearer token
HttpPost httpPost = new HttpPost("https://api.twitter.com/oauth2/token");
httpPost.setHeader("Authorization", "Basic " + base64Encoded);
httpPost.setHeader("Content-Type", "application/x-www-form-urlencoded;charset=UTF-8");
httpPost.setEntity(new StringEntity("grant_type=client_credentials"));
JSONObject rawAuthorization = new JSONObject(getResponseBody(httpPost));
String auth = JWalk.getString(rawAuthorization, "access_token");
// Applications should verify that the value associated with the
// token_type key of the returned object is bearer
if (auth != null && JWalk.getString(rawAuthorization, "token_type").equals("bearer")) {
// Step 3: Authenticate API requests with bearer token
HttpGet httpGet =
new HttpGet("https://api.twitter.com/1.1/statuses/user_timeline.json?screen_name=" + screenName);
// construct a normal HTTPS request and include an Authorization
// header with the value of Bearer <>
httpGet.setHeader("Authorization", "Bearer " + auth);
httpGet.setHeader("Content-Type", "application/json");
// update the results with the body of the response
results = getResponseBody(httpGet);
}
} catch (UnsupportedEncodingException ex) {
} catch (JSONException ex) {
} catch (IllegalStateException ex1) {
}
return results;
}
private static String getResponseBody(HttpRequestBase request) {
StringBuilder sb = new StringBuilder();
try {
DefaultHttpClient httpClient = new DefaultHttpClient(new BasicHttpParams());
HttpResponse response = httpClient.execute(request);
int statusCode = response.getStatusLine().getStatusCode();
String reason = response.getStatusLine().getReasonPhrase();
if (statusCode == 200) {
HttpEntity entity = response.getEntity();
InputStream inputStream = entity.getContent();
BufferedReader bReader = new BufferedReader(
new InputStreamReader(inputStream, "UTF-8"), 8);
String line = null;
while ((line = bReader.readLine()) != null) {
sb.append(line);
}
} else {
sb.append(reason);
}
} catch (UnsupportedEncodingException ex) {
} catch (ClientProtocolException ex1) {
} catch (IOException ex2) {
}
return sb.toString();
}
@Override
protected String fetchResource(OperationLog log, int indent) {
return getTwitterStream("Valodim");
}
}
